MSD BAP here and my stock pump failed. Replaced it and got a real fuel system and no issues ever since. Stock pumps arent made to run on 22 volts. Powerlabs had the same issue. The deciding factor appears to be how hard you drive you car and if you let the fuel level go under 1/4 tank which overheats the pump (fuel cools it).
To each his own but just keep in mind you count failures to get a failure rate, not pumps that didnt fail yet on cars that dont get driven hard for a few hours at a time. If you dont spend time in high boost much then your pump isnt getting much of a voltage workout.
